The basis of the grill is cool to the touch, which makes it safe when around children and pets. The grill is also healthy as the fat and oil drop down to the charcoal. This means that there is no smoke flare-ups. Don't judge this grill by size only either. The Cobb can easily Cook for 4 to 6 persons.

This is one of the most unique grills on the market. It is very easy to use and you can pick it up and move if you want to. The kitchenette is about 12 inches, but you can cook a whole lot more than you think. It is also able to run for up to three hours just 8 briquettes.
